What's Happening?
Carter, a player for the Texas Rangers, took batting practice on Monday and is expected to begin a rehab assignment as early as Tuesday. This development comes as the Rangers prepare for their upcoming games, with Carter's return potentially bolstering their lineup. The Arizona Diamondbacks and Texas Rangers are both competing in their respective divisions, with the Diamondbacks currently positioned fourth in the NL West and the Rangers third in the AL West.
